    Performance of Strong Ionic Hydrogels Based on 2-Acrylamido-2-Methylpropane Sulfonate as Draw Agents for Forward Osmosis

    Source: Journal of Environmental Engineering:;2014:;Volume ( 140 ):;issue: 012
